Preparation and characterisation of layered metal hydroxides intercalated with ciprofloxacin and ethacrynic acid for slow drug release
In this study, two model drugs, ciprofloxacin (CFX) and ethacrynic acid (ECA) are intercalated in layered zinc hydroxides (LZH) and layered double hydroxides (LDH) host materials via either anion exchange or co-precipitation methods.
